I am a native of Wisconsin and full-blooded cheese head. I can't imagine living anywhere else. I love the changing seasons and the variety of terrain that characterizes our great state. We have hills and bluffs as well as vast expanses of rolling farmland, our bounty of lakes and streams, a great assortment of evergreen and deciduous trees, wild and cultivated flowers and a vast array of indigenous wildlife offers more landscape inspiration than I could use in five lifetimes!!
I have always been an artist, but I think almost everyone is in one way or another. Maybe that's the teacher in me talking, but I truly believe we are all born with the desire to bring something into this world to make it a better place, for ourselves or for others. If we just broaden our definition we begin to realize that a lovingly restored automobile, a well tended flower garden and a fresh batch of chocolate chip cookies aren't that different from a successful painting. None of these things would exist without a creator and in their own way, each makes our world a nicer place to be.
I love to paint, but make no mistake, it's hard work and it's rarely easy. In fact, if it seems easy, that usually means I'm botching something up in a big way! Sometimes I think I may be a bit of a masochist, or maybe it's my stubborn Norwegian heritage but I don't like to give up. For me a painting needs to be just right or set aside to be reworked at another time. I have one painting that has been completely redone three different times!
On a more personal note, I live in River Falls,Wisconsin with my two cats, Boje and Marmelade where I teach K-5 art. My students are fabulous. They keep me young. You just can't beat the sincerity and enthusiasm of elementary aged children.
